Unglazed solar collectors are used to pre-heat make-up ventilation air in commercial,institutional and industrial buildings with a high ventilation load. They turn building walls or sections of walls into low cost, high performance, unglazed solar collectors. They employ a painted, perforated metal solar heat absorber that
also serves as the exterior wall surface of the building. Heat conducts from the absorber surface to the thermal boundary layer of the air 1mm thick on the
outside of the absorber and to air that passes behind the absorber. Theboundary layer of air is drawn into a nearby perforation before the heat can
escape by convection to the outside air. The heated air is then drawn from behind the absorber plate into the building’s ventilation system.
